The term "ISO" refers to a disc image file used to create bootable media (like DVDs or USB drives) for installing an operating system on a computer.
Google does not release Android TV as an ISO. Android TV is an embedded operating system. It is designed to be pre-installed by hardware manufacturers (like Sony, Philips, or Nvidia) onto specific hardware with specific drivers. It is not designed to be installed on a generic x86 PC architecture in the same way Windows is.
To summarize, an official, universal Android TV 13 ISO does not exist. The term is a colloquial shorthand for various types of system images—factory images, burn packages, or virtual machine disks—each tied to specific hardware or use cases.

While Google officially released Android TV 13 as a developer-focused update, there is no official, consumer-ready ISO file provided directly by Google for standard PC installation. However, the enthusiast community has developed Android TV x86 ISOs that allow you to run the operating system on laptops, desktops, or virtual machines. What is an Android TV 13 ISO?
An ISO is a "disk image" that contains the entire operating system. Because standard Android TV is built for ARM processors (like those in smart TVs and Chromecasts), these community-made x86 ISOs are specifically modified to work on the Intel or AMD processors found in most PCs. Android TV 13 (ISO) is primarily a developer-focused release rather than a consumer update for existing smart TVs. However, it has gained popularity as a way to repurpose old PCs and laptops into dedicated entertainment hubs using bootable ISO files. Key Features in Android TV 13
The update focuses on back-end performance, accessibility, and improved hardware communication rather than a major visual overhaul:
Media & HDMI: Users can now manually adjust the default resolution and refresh rate on supported HDMI source devices for smoother playback.
Power Management: Improved standby modes allow devices to save power by pausing content automatically when HDMI states change (e.g., turning off the TV).
Input Controls: A new Keyboard Layouts API supports various language layouts for external physical keyboards.
Accessibility: System-wide audio description preferences help developers automatically provide narration for visually impaired users.
Privacy: Hardware mute switch states are now better integrated into the system's privacy controls. How People are Using the ISO
Since Android TV 13 isn't widely available as an OTA (Over-the-Air) update for most consumer TVs, users are turning to ISO files to run the OS on different hardware.
Live USB (No Installation): You can "flash" the ISO to a USB drive using tools like Rufus or BalenaEtcher. This allows you to boot into Android TV 13 directly from the pen drive without touching your computer's existing files.
Permanent PC Conversion: Some choose to install the ISO permanently on a hard drive or external SSD to transform an old desktop into a fast, responsive smart TV box.
Virtual Machines & Emulators: Developers use the Android Emulator within Android Studio to test apps against the new APIs and behavior changes.
Android TV 13 was officially released in December 2022 as a developer-focused update. Unlike standard desktop operating systems, Google does not provide a general-purpose "Android TV 13 ISO" for public installation on standard PCs. Official Availability
Official Android TV 13 system images are primarily distributed for specialized developer hardware and testing environments:
ADT-3 Developer Kit: Factory images are available for developers to flash onto Google's dedicated ADT-3 hardware. Example: Using an AMLogic S905X4 box with a
Android Emulator: Developers can download Android TV 13 system images (API level 33) through the SDK Manager in Android Studio to test apps on a virtual TV interface. Third-Party Android TV 13 ISOs for PC
Because there is no official PC installer, independent developers have created custom "Android TV x86" projects to bridge the gap. These allow you to run the TV interface on standard 64-bit computers:
AndroidTV-x86 Project: Community-led builds like those hosted on SourceForge offer ISO files for Android TV 13 and 14 designed for x86_64 hardware.
Live USB Methods: Many users use tools like Rufus to flash these ISOs to a USB drive, allowing them to boot into Android TV 13 without a full hard drive installation. Key Features in Android TV 13

Android TV 13 (Android TV OS 13) is a developer-focused release that brings significant behind-the-scenes improvements to performance, accessibility, and hardware management for the big screen
. While it was officially released for developers in December 2022, it is primarily intended for use with specific development kits rather than general consumer devices. Android Developers Key Features and Improvements
Android TV 13 focuses on refining the user interaction and hardware efficiency: Media & Power
: New APIs allow apps to identify supported audio formats and routed devices before playback begins. It also introduces improved power management for low-power standby modes and better handling of HDMI state changes to pause content or save power. Input & Accessibility
: Users can now change the default resolution and refresh rate on supported HDMI source devices. It adds a new Keyboard Layouts API
to support different language layouts for external keyboards and global preferences for audio descriptions.
: System-level privacy controls now reflect the state of hardware mute switches, and remote microphone access for Google Assistant has been updated with clearer user controls. Android Developers Installation and ISO Options
